). Scutum triangular with occludent margin convex. Right scutum with inner umbonal tooth, sometimes rudimentary. Scutum sometimes with dark marking or spots, carina branched below umbo. Tergum triangular to quadrangular with occludent margin convex or angular, apex almost truncated. Carina generally smooth, occasionally barbed. Peduncle variable in length, sometimes several times longer than capitulum. Caudal appendages short and claw-shaped. Maxilla globular with setae over margins (Fig.
